> Do you just want replacement springs for your stock shocks? Or are you looking for a complete replacement shock/spring package?
>
> Precision Proformance, Hall Pantera (and perhaps some others) sell replacement springs for the stock shocks, which are lower and stiffer than the standard springs...Precision lists them for $240 for the set.
>
> Precision and Hall both sell Aldan coilover packages--new shocks and springs. I wouldn't put them on a shopping cart--their failure rate is outrageously high. If I was going to get new shocks and springs, I'd get Konis from Pantera Performance Center or Pantera East, as a first choice, and Carrera/QA1 from Wilkinson as a second choice. Larry Stock carries the same shocks, but he fits them with ridiculously light springs (lighter than stock, in fact) which makes for a Cadillac ride, but if you drive your car with sporting intent, it bounces all over the road...:<(
>
> In all cases, you're looking at $1000-1400 depending on various options etc....which is a reasonable price.
